Farms in this area are planted with special varieties from countries like Italy, France, Spain, and Greece. Some have special types meant for high density orchards. Northern California has some of the oldest trees dating back to when they were first introduced.

Most fields are planted with a wide range of varietals. The varietals are then harvested together and processed. The reason for this practice is that great olive oils are usually a blend of multiple varietals. A single varietal does not produce much interesting oil. The other method involves harvesting then pressing the varietal individually before blending the resultant oils. This method is used in making wine.

After the trees are planted care must be given to sustain their health. Care involves watering, mowing, and pruning among others. Olive flies are the the worst pests to be warned about. Plans for treatment have to be in position to keep them in check before they strike. It should be understood that any infested fruit is useless as it cannot be used to make olive oil and is unfit for consumption.
